Schedule 9ZA, Part 9, paragraph 56

VATA 1994
Value Added Tax Act 1994 · United Kingdom

For the purposes of this Part of this Schedule “relevant supply” means a supply of goods that— involves the removal of the goods to Northern Ireland from a place outside the United Kingdom by or under the directions of the person making the supply, does not involve the installation or assembly of the goods at a place in Northern Ireland, is a transaction in pursuance of which goods are acquired in Northern Ireland from a member State by a person who is not a taxable person, is made in the course or furtherance of a business carried on by the supplier, and is neither an exempt supply nor a supply of goods which are subject to a duty of excise or consist in a new means of transport and is not anything which is treated as a supply for the purposes of this Act by virtue only of paragraph 5(1) of Schedule 4 or paragraph 30 of Schedule 9ZB.
